Output e9516ad3370963e44a62414dc59bccb7a023b2d889b6cd4758e0fc1142763cdf:0

value
3321824
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8b71248be389b185ecbf4b5a4b0da953e243b09 OP_EQUAL
address
MTf3VtdYJ3qUegCercRcqJQkz5hPdgSx7R
transaction
e9516ad3370963e44a62414dc59bccb7a023b2d889b6cd4758e0fc1142763cdf
spent
true